Originally posted by bmwguru:

I set all my rev limiters to cut the spark and not the fuel, so the engine will not go lean when it cuts in. It is also a smoother cut out than having the fuel cut first. I also am getting very skilled with the hp tuners software.....and spent the extra cash on their tuning school books...which did clear up a few things.
Dave



Oh how I ever wish that was true, but you can NOT turn spark off on a 3800 for any reason. The only thing you can do is subtract a lot of spark advance so it runs poorly (which is not that reliable in all operating systems for some reason).

I am still debating going to a MSD system ($500+) for JUST the ability to cut spark.
